#01e435 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#01e435 is composed of 0.4% red, 89.4% green and 20.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 99.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 76.8% yellow and 10.6% black. It has a hue angle of 133.7 degrees, a saturation of 99.1% and a lightness of 44.9%. #01e435 color hex could be obtained by blending #02ff6a with #00c900. Closest websafe color is: #00cc33.

Shades and Tints of #01e435
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000d03 is the darkest color, while #f9fffa is the lightest one.
